What to Check Before Opening an Account

A casino account should be easy to understand before money changes hands. Begin with the operator’s legal information, responsible gambling tools, age restrictions, and identity checks. UK players should also look for clear references to the applicable regulatory framework and data protection practices.

  • Confirm that the site displays relevant licensing and company information.
  • Read bonus terms separately from the promotional headline.
  • Check minimum deposits, withdrawal limits, processing times, and possible fees.
  • Review available self-exclusion, deposit-limit, and reality-check controls.
  • Test customer support with a specific question before making a deposit.

Verification can feel like paperwork wearing a casino jacket, but it serves a purpose. Operators may request identification, address confirmation, or payment ownership evidence. Completing these checks early can reduce friction later, particularly when a larger withdrawal triggers additional review.

Games, Software, and the Question of Fairness

Game variety is useful only when it comes with reliable software and transparent rules. Slots may dominate the lobby, while live roulette, blackjack, baccarat, and video poker appeal to players who prefer a slower rhythm. A well-organised catalogue should explain volatility, paylines, side bets, and return-to-player information where relevant.

Game category What to examine Potential concern
Slots RTP, volatility, paylines, bonus features Fast play can make losses difficult to notice
Live casino Rules, table limits, studio provider, streaming quality Side bets may carry weaker value
Table games House edge, rule variations, betting limits Small rule changes can alter expected returns
Jackpots Eligibility, contribution model, prize conditions Large figures do not imply frequent wins

Random number generators and live-game procedures should be tested or overseen through recognised controls. That does not turn gambling into an investment, naturally; a fair coin still lands on the wrong side often enough to annoy the financially optimistic. RTP is a long-run statistical measure, not a personal forecast.

Payments and Withdrawals Without the Fog

Payment methods often reveal how practical a platform is. Card deposits, bank transfers, and selected e-wallets may be available, but availability can depend on verification status, account currency, and local banking policies. A method that accepts deposits may not necessarily support withdrawals, so read the small print before committing funds.

Withdrawal speed deserves a cautious reading. “Fast processing” may refer only to the operator’s internal approval, while the bank or payment provider takes additional time. Look for stated review periods, transaction limits, cancellation rules, and any requirement to return funds through the original method.

Questions Worth Asking Support

  • How long are standard withdrawals held for review?
  • Are there limits per transaction, day, or month?
  • Which documents are accepted for verification?
  • Can pending withdrawals be cancelled, and what happens afterward?

Bonuses: Read the Arithmetic, Not the Fireworks

Promotions can improve entertainment value, but only when the maths is comfortable. A welcome offer may include a deposit match, free spins, cashback, or a combination of conditions. The headline amount is rarely the whole story; wagering requirements, maximum bet clauses, eligible games, expiry dates, and withdrawal caps can reshape the offer considerably.

Consider a simple example: a bonus of £50 with a 35x wagering requirement may require £1,750 in qualifying play, depending on the terms. Game contribution rates can alter that figure, and restricted games may contribute nothing. Promotional language that sounds generous can therefore behave like a magician’s sleeve—plenty of movement, not always much substance.

Responsible Play and Final Assessment

Good gambling habits are not decorative safety notices. Set a budget before playing, use deposit limits, avoid chasing losses, and pause when the session stops feeling recreational. If gambling affects finances, sleep, relationships, or mood, step away and seek help through recognised support services.
